-#!/bin/bash
-#
-# Copyright 2021 The Chromium OS Authors. All rights reserved.
-# Use of this source code is governed by a BSD-style license that can be
-# found in the LICENSE file.
-
-# convert_image.sh --board=[board] --image_type=[type] --image_format=[format]
-#
-# This script converts a board's image(base, test, dev) to the specified format
-# like vmdk, vhd so that the image can be used by platform other than GCP.
-#
-SCRIPT_ROOT=$(dirname $(readlink -f "$0"))
-SCRIPT_ROOT=${SCRIPT_ROOT%cos}
-. "${SCRIPT_ROOT}/build_library/build_common.sh" || exit 1
-
-# Script must be run inside the chroot.
-restart_in_chroot_if_needed "$@"
-
-DEFINE_string board "${DEFAULT_BOARD}" \
- "The board to build an image for."
-DEFINE_string image_type "base" \
- "Image type to process, base, test or dev."
-DEFINE_string image_format "" \
- "Image format to be converted to, vmdk or vhd."
-DEFINE_string image_dir "" "Path to the folder to store netboot images."
-
-# Parse command line.
-FLAGS "$@" || exit 1
-eval set -- "${FLAGS_ARGV}"
-
-. "${SCRIPT_ROOT}/build_library/build_common.sh" || exit 1
-. "${BUILD_LIBRARY_DIR}/board_options.sh" || exit 1
-
-switch_to_strict_mode
-
-set -x
-# build_packages artifact output.
-SYSROOT="${GCLIENT_ROOT}/chroot/build/${FLAGS_board}"
-# build_image artifact output.
-
-IMAGE_DIR="${CHROOT_TRUNK_DIR}"/src/build/images/"${FLAGS_board}"/latest
-if [ -n "${FLAGS_image_dir}" ]; then
- IMAGE_DIR=${FLAGS_image_dir}
-fi
-IMAGE_TYPE=${FLAGS_image_type}
-
-case ${FLAGS_image_format} in
- "vmdk")
- qemu-img convert -p -o subformat=streamOptimized -O vmdk\
- ${IMAGE_DIR}/chromiumos_${IMAGE_TYPE}_image.bin \
- ${IMAGE_DIR}/chromiumos_${IMAGE_TYPE}_image.vmdk
- ;;
-
- "vhd")
- qemu-img convert -f raw -o subformat=fixed,force_size -O vpc \
- ${IMAGE_DIR}/chromiumos_${IMAGE_TYPE}_image.bin \
- ${IMAGE_DIR}/chromiumos_${IMAGE_TYPE}_image.vhd
- ;;
-
- *)
- ;;
-esac

-#!/bin/bash
-#
-# Copyright 2021 The Chromium OS Authors. All rights reserved.
-# Use of this source code is governed by a BSD-style license that can be
-# found in the LICENSE file.
-#
-# make_ova.sh -d [vmdk file] -o [ova file] -p[product-name] \
-# -n[image-name] -t ${TEMPLATE_OVF}
-#
-# This scripts creates .ova file from given disk image and OVA template.
-#
-
-set -o xtrace
-set -o errexit
-set -o nounset
-
-SCRIPT_ROOT=$(dirname $(readlink -f "$0"))
-TEMPLATE_PATH=${SCRIPT_ROOT}/template.ovf
-WORKSPACE=${SCRIPT_ROOT%\/src\/scripts\/cos}
-BOARD=anthos-amd64-vsphere
-PRODUCT_NAME="Anthos OnPrem on COS"
-IMAGE_NAME="COS"
-IMAGE_TYPE="test"
-IMAGE_ROOT=${WORKSPACE}/src/build/images/${BOARD}/latest
-DISK_FILE=${IMAGE_ROOT}/chromiumos_${IMAGE_TYPE}_image.vmdk
-OUTPUT_FILE=${IMAGE_ROOT}/chromiumos_${IMAGE_TYPE}_image.ova
-
-usage() {
- echo "Usage: $0 -b board -d disk.vmdk \
- -p product-name -n image-name \
- -o output-file [-t template.ovf]"
-}
-
-while getopts ":b:d:p:n:t:o:h" arg; do
- case $arg in
- b) BOARDD=$OPTARG ;;
- d) DISK_FILE=$OPTARG ;;
- p) PRODUCT_NAME=$OPTARG ;;
- n) IMAGE_NAME=$OPTARG ;;
- t) TEMPLATE_PATH=$OPTARG ;;
- o) OUTPUT_FILE=$OPTARG ;;
- h)
- usage
- exit 0
- ;;
- *)
- usage
- exit 1
- ;;
- esac
-done
-
-: "${BOARD?Missing -d BOARD value}"
-: "${DISK_FILE?Missing -d DISK_FILE value}"
-: "${PRODUCT_NAME?Missing -p PRODUCT_NAME value}"
-: "${IMAGE_NAME?Missing -n IMAGE_NAME value}"
-: "${TEMPLATE_PATH?Missing -t TEMPLATE_PATH value}"
-: "${OUTPUT_FILE?Missing -o OUTPUT_FILE value}"
-
-if [[ ! -f ${TEMPLATE_PATH} ]]; then
- echo "Cannot find template at ${TEMPLATE_PATH}"
- exit 1
-fi
-
-XML_NS=(
- -N 'x=http://schemas.dmtf.org/ovf/envelope/1'
- -N 'ovf=http://schemas.dmtf.org/ovf/envelope/1'
- -N 'vssd=http://schemas.dmtf.org/wbem/wscim/1/cim-schema/2/CIM_VirtualSystemSettingData'
-)
-
-WORK_DIR=$(mktemp -d)
-trap 'rm -rf "${WORK_DIR}"' EXIT
-
-# xmlstar does not support multiple updates at once, and we need to provide
-# namespaces to every invocation, so disable quoting warning.
-# shellcheck disable=SC2086
-xmlstarlet ed ${XML_NS[*]} \
- --update '//x:VirtualSystem/@ovf:id' --value "${IMAGE_NAME}" \
- "${TEMPLATE_PATH}" \
- | xmlstarlet ed ${XML_NS[*]} \
- --update '//x:VirtualSystem/x:Name' --value "${IMAGE_NAME}" \
- | xmlstarlet ed ${XML_NS[*]} \
- --update '//vssd:VirtualSystemIdentifier' --value "${IMAGE_NAME}" \
- > "${WORK_DIR}/tmp.ovf"
-
-# Add a disk image to temporary .ovf
-cot --force add-disk "${DISK_FILE}" "${WORK_DIR}/tmp.ovf" \
- -o "${WORK_DIR}/image.ovf" \
- -f vmdisk1 -t harddisk -c scsi
-
-# Add product information and convert .ovf to .ova
-cot --force edit-product "${WORK_DIR}/image.ovf" \
- -o "${OUTPUT_FILE}" \
- --product "${PRODUCT_NAME}"
-
